Focus on Geography Series, 2021 Census of Population
Nunavut, Territory
Religion
Religion: In 2021, the top religious group was Anglican, with about 14,300 persons representing 39.1% of the total population. The second group was Catholic, with about 8,235 persons representing 22.5% of the total population. The population who declared no religion and secular perspectives numbered 9,115 persons, representing 24.9% of the total population.
Racialized groups
Racialized groupsFootnote 1: In 2021, the largest racialized group was Black, with about 565 persons representing 1.5% of the total population. The second group was Filipino, with about 315 persons representing 0.9% of the total population. The third group was South Asian, with about 180 persons representing 0.5% of the total population.
Ethnic or cultural origins
Ethnic or cultural origins: In 2021, the most frequently reported ethnic or cultural origin was Inuit, n.o.s., with about 30,700 persons representing 83.9% of the total population. The second origin was Scottish, with about 2,100 persons representing 5.7% of the total population. The third origin was Irish, with about 1,585 persons representing 4.3% of the total population.

The 10 most frequently reported ethnic or cultural origins by median age, Nunavut, 2021
| Ethnic or cultural origin | Number of responses | % | Rank | Median age |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Inuit, n.o.s. | 30,700 | 83.9 | 1 | 22.6 |
| Scottish | 2,100 | 5.7 | 2 | 31.6 |
| Irish | 1,585 | 4.3 | 3 | 34.0 |
| English | 1,405 | 3.8 | 4 | 35.2 |
| Canadian | 1,025 | 2.8 | 5 | 30.8 |
| French, n.o.s. | 880 | 2.4 | 6 | 33.2 |
| German | 605 | 1.7 | 7 | 32.0 |
| Caucasian (White), n.o.s. | 605 | 1.7 | 7 | 25.6 |
| European, n.o.s. | 395 | 1.1 | 9 | 29.8 |
| Filipino | 310 | 0.8 | 10 | 36.4 |

Population by visible minority groupFootnote 2 and median age, Nunavut, 2016 and 2021
| 2016 | 2021 | |||||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Number | % of total population | % of visible minority population | Median age | Number | % of total population | % of visible minority population | Median age | |
| Total - Visible minority | 35,580 | 100.0 | ... | 27.6 | 36,600 | 100.0 | ... | 25.6 |
| Total visible minority population | 905 | 2.5 | 100.0 | 35.1 | 1,325 | 3.6 | 100.0 | 37.2 |
| South Asian | 115 | 0.3 | 12.6 | 38.8 | 180 | 0.5 | 13.6 | 37.2 |
| Chinese | 75 | 0.2 | 7.7 | 39.0 | 65 | 0.2 | 5.3 | 39.2 |
| Black | 330 | 0.9 | 35.7 | 33.3 | 565 | 1.5 | 42.6 | 35.6 |
| Filipino | 235 | 0.7 | 25.3 | 34.8 | 315 | 0.9 | 23.4 | 38.8 |
| Arab | 40 | 0.1 | 4.4 | 35.5 | 35 | 0.1 | 2.6 | 32.4 |
| Latin American | 40 | 0.1 | 4.4 | 35.5 | 60 | 0.2 | 4.2 | 38.0 |
| Southeast Asian | 30 | 0.1 | 2.7 | 29.0 | 15 | 0.0 | 1.5 | ... |
| West Asian | 10 | 0.0 | 1.1 | 45.0 | 0 | 0.0 | 0.0 | ... |
| Korean | 10 | 0.0 | 1.1 | 38.0 | 10 | 0.0 | 0.0 | ... |
| Japanese | 0 | 0.0 | 0.0 | ... | 10 | 0.0 | 0.8 | ... |
| Visible minority, n.i.e. | 20 | 0.1 | 2.2 | 34.0 | 20 | 0.1 | 1.5 | 42.0 |
| Multiple visible minorities | 10 | 0.0 | 1.1 | 32.0 | 50 | 0.1 | 3.8 | 28.4 |
